How to build up the confidence of speaking in English ?

Dear Friends,

Very few students can study in posh convent schools and learn accented English. Most of the Indian youth have studied English as a 2nd Langauge and that too not very seriously as our daily environment did not give the due importance to English. We somehow got the working knowledge of English and cleared our school and college Exams only to realise later that fluency in the English Language is of paramount importance in any and every professional sphere. If one wants to gain expertise in his/her field, make presentations, convince clients, impress Bosses and associates, a full command of spoken English is necessary.

Confidence in the English Language comes with knowledge and practice. For knowledge along with hard work on the part of the student, a proper direction to the hard work and regular feedback from the teacher is significant. Even after gaining knowledge of the language, grammar, vocabulary and proper sentence formations, speaking in front of 10 people remains a challenge and drives even the talented students to sweaty dizziness. It can be overcome with repetition and repetition and again repitition with the support of the teacher. After a short, while one starts seeing the progress in oneself and also starts realising the approach of others towards them, be it academic atmosphere or workplace or friend circle. A person with good language and communications skill is always appreciated by people around and thereby lands up better opportunities as compared to people who lack such soft skills.

However, there is no shortcut to Hard work of Learning and Practising.
